Activities to Teach Students to Estimate Differences Using Compatible Numbers
Estimating differences using compatible numbers is an important skill for students to learn. Compatible numbers are numbers that are close in value to the actual numbers and are easy to work with when performing mental calculations. By using compatible numbers, students can make quick and accurate estimates of differences without having to use a calculator or pen and paper.
Here are some activities to help teach students how to estimate differences using compatible numbers.
1. Real-World Examples
One way to introduce students to the concept of estimating differences using compatible numbers is to provide real-world examples. For instance, students can estimate the difference in price between two items in a store. They could also estimate the difference in weight between two objects or estimate the difference in time between two events.
2. Number Line Activity
Create a number line on the board or on a worksheet with several points marked on it. Ask students to estimate the difference between two of the points using compatible numbers. 3. Partner Game
Pair students together and give each pair a set of index cards with numbers between 1-50. Students take turns selecting two cards and estimating the difference between the two numbers using compatible numbers. The partner then checks the estimate using a calculator and gives feedback.
4. Estimation Jar
Fill a jar with objects such as marbles, buttons, or beads. Ask students to estimate the difference in the number of objects in the jar when some are removed or add, using compatible numbers. Challenge students to take turns modifying the jar’s contents and estimate the difference between the two collections.
